BTW, I picked up Stack-On's double-door model GCD-924-5 several weeks ago and like it a lot. Not fire-proof, but sturdy enough for its purpose, and easy to move and set up. Comes pre-drilled to bolt to the floor or a wall, and pre-drilled on top to accommodate one of their smaller handgun safes.
